Green Brick Partners CEO ist Jim Brickman , ernannt in Oct 2014, hat eine Amtszeit von 11.58 Jahren. Die jährliche Gesamtvergütung beträgt $8.18M , bestehend aus 18.6% Gehalt und 81.4% Boni, einschließlich Aktien und Optionen des Unternehmens. besitzt direkt 4.53% der Aktien des Unternehmens, im Wert von $128.30M . Die durchschnittliche Betriebszugehörigkeit des Managementteams und des Verwaltungsrats beträgt 5.5 Jahre bzw. 11.6 Jahre.

Summary Green Brick Partners excels with a traditional homebuilding model, self-developing land, and maintaining industry-leading margins and low leverage, unlike peers using the land-light model. The company benefits from strategic locations in high-growth markets like Texas, Georgia, and Florida, and is well-positioned to capitalize on long-term demographic shifts. Strong financials include a low debt-to-capital ratio, robust liquidity, and significant cash reserves, providing flexibility and stability in a cyclical industry. Despite market cyclicality, GBRK's attractive valuation and demand-supply imbalance in the US housing market present a compelling buy opportunity for patient investors.
